I'm selling a woma python who is roughly 4 years old, and she's a little over 4 ft. I'm a little reluctant to sell her so I will be taking my time to make sure she goes to a good home. Currently she's living in a 4x2x2 but she's very active and I would love to see her go in a 6-foot enclosure. I was hoping to get a 6x2x3 for her but I've got too many things in the works to do that right now. She really utilizes climbing opportunities. She has a few larger logs going over the span of her enclosure and she sleeps on them regularly out in the open in the middle of the day. She's full of personality and isn't cage aggressive which some of them can be. She is very food motivated though so take caution moving your hands around her head in the enclosure, but once she's out she forgets about food and calmly cruises around. I will also provide a couple months worth of food with her. She's currently eating quail and rats. Prices firm and very fair in my opinion as she is an adult female woma with very nice coloration. I know that since Australia doesn't allow export of them most of the localities have been mixed however compared to most she is very bright. She has a deep orange belly a bright orange head and orange banding throughout her body, most womas seem to be darker. Also although it's not considered to be necessary they do come from a Australia and she basks all the time so I would recommend overhead heating as well as UVB. I use a Arcadia Deep heat projector and a 2 ft Arcadia UVB 6%, although she will not be coming with that. Let me know if you have any more questions thank you
